The wholesale sector is undergoing significant changes as B2B supplier relationships evolve. Understanding these trends is crucial for businesses looking to maintain a competitive edge.
Several trends are reshaping the landscape of wholesale, including increased transparency, automation, and a shift towards just-in-time inventory models. Suppliers must adapt to these changes to meet market demands.
Modern buyers demand transparency in the supply chain. Suppliers are now expected to provide detailed information about product sourcing, production practices, and pricing structures.
Automation is streamlining processes in wholesale, enabling suppliers to manage orders and inventory more efficiently. This leads to reduced operational costs and improved customer satisfaction.
As the wholesale market changes, building strong relationships with suppliers becomes increasingly important. Trust and collaboration are essential for navigating the complexities of modern trade.
Effective communication fosters strong partnerships. Regular updates and feedback can help suppliers align their offerings with buyer expectations.
